MECHANICS' LIEN CLAIM
AND NOW comes Plaintiff, BBGY, Inc. d/b/a Boger Concrete Company, by and through
its attorneys, Dell & Homsher, and hereby files this Mechanic's Lien Claim against Olde Forge
Builders, Inc., owner and against the property hereinafter described for the payment of a debt due
Claimant as a sub-subcontractor for the services furnished by Claimant in construction of the
owner's property. In support of the claim, the Claimant makes the following statement:
1. Claimant, BBGY, Inc. d/b/a Boger Concrete Company, is a Pennsylvania business
with offices located at 201 Iron Valley Drive, Lebanon, PA 17042 and files this
mechanic's lien claim as sub-subcontractor.
2. The owner of the property subject to the lien is Olde Forge Builders, Inc., 9
Keystone Drive, Mechanicsburg, PA 17050
3. The date on which Claimant completed the work for which claim is made was
November 26, 2008.
4. Claimant contracted with Cassel Concrete, subcontractor of Olde Forge Builders,
Inc. and gave formal notice of its intention to file this claim on April 2, 2009.
5. This claim is made for the following labor and materials:
Delivered and poured ready mixed concrete $2,620.85
6. The amount claimed to be due is $2,620.85 plus interest.
7. The improvement and property claimed to be subject to the lien is 1365 Armitage
Way, Hampton Township, located in Cumberland County Pennsylvania.
